What is a prepositional pronoun?
A pronoun that comes after a preposition (de, para, con, etc)
e.g. Este regalo es para ti.
This gift is for you.
Prepositional pronoun of: yo
mí
Prepositional pronoun of: tú
ti
Prepositional pronoun of: él
él
Prepositional pronoun of: ella
ella
Prepositional pronoun of: usted
usted
Prepositional pronoun of: nosotros
nosotros
Prepositional pronoun of: ellos
ellos
Prepositional pronoun of: ustedes
ustedes
When can you use the pronoun ‘sí’? (2)
– instead of él, ella, ellos or ellas
– when these are used reflexively
(i.e. when the subject and object are the same person).
EXAMPLES
Cree que lo puede hacer por sí solo.
He thinks he can do it all by himself.
What preposition has its own rules and what are they?
Con (with)
Three prepositional pronouns change form.
1) con + mí = conmigo
2) con + ti = contigo
3) con + sí = consigo (with himself/herself)
* *only used reflexively, otherwise use con él/ella**
What 2 pronouns are not used after what 6 prepositions?
Pronouns:
mí and ti
Prepositions:
(MISSEE)
menos (except) incluso (including) salvo (except) según (according to) entre (between) excepto (except)
